And since September 11th, the song has remained the most Shazamed song in the world, beating out the Kid Laroi and Justin Beibers . A remix of the song titled "Love Nwantiti (Ah Ah Ah)" featuring Nigerian singer Joeboy and Ghanaian singer Kuami Eugene, released as a single in 2020, became a commercial success in Nigeria,[3] Middle East, North Africa and in many European club venues, as well as the subject of collaborations with few local artists for localised variations. Joseph says she didnt actually find out about the strike until two weeks after it started. Though his father was a choirmaster and taught him to play classical music, Chukwuka Ekweani's academic brilliance made a music career undesirable for his middle class parents. "Love Nwantinti" means small love in Igbo, the language in which CKay sings a better part of the song. Hi there! Long story short, woke up in the morning and realized it was fire exactly how it was., Even as the records now are set straight for Love Nwantiti, questions still remain around how TikTok can ensure emerging music artists stay at the center of their songs when they begin to blow up.
